For more than a century, scientists have sought to reconstruct human evolution using diverse lines of evidence, including fossils, genetic variation across populations and ancient DNA. Building on these approaches, researchers are increasingly using large population biobanks to investigate how natural selection continues to shape the genomes of living populations.
